I do not think that buying a domain name for 1 or 10 years would help you in the search engines. I do know that Google likes domain names that are a little older... so maybe after a few years, Google will add value to your site ranking because it's been around for some time.

But Google's criteria change all the time. I wouldn't worry about the changes, though, because they tend to improve in the favor of better websites... for example, it would be able to distinguish (if they don't already) between a domain name that has been parked for 10 years versus a 10 year old site that continues to get updated with fresh content.
